本文以《VS2012 3核心功能深度解析与实际应用场景全方位指南》为中心,全面剖析了Visual Studio 2012在现代软件开发中的三大核心功能及其实际应用场景。文章从集成开发环境的优化、代码调试与分析工具、团队协作与版本控制三个方面展开深入探讨,通过具体案例和实践经验,揭示了VS2012在提高开发效率、保证代码质量以及支持多人协作方面的独特优势。同时,文章还结合实际应用场景,提供了功能使用策略和操作技巧,帮助开发者在真实项目中充分发挥VS2012的潜力,从而实现更高效的开发流程和更稳定的软件产品。整篇内容系统全面,为软件开发人员提供了实用指导和参考。
VS2012的集成开发环境(IDE)在用户体验和操作效率上进行了显著优化。通过界面自定义和快捷键配置,开发者可以根据个人习惯快速切换功能模块,从而提高代码编写效率。在实际项目中,这种优化能显著减少重复操作,提高开发速度。
此外,VS2012支持多语言开发和项目模板管理,使开发者能够在同一环境下完成C#、VB.NET、C++等语言的混合开发。通过模板快速创建项目结构,有助于团队在不同项目间保持一致的开发规范和代码风格。
VS2012内置了先进的调试工具,包括断点管理、实时变量监控和异常跟踪功能。这些工具可以帮助开发者迅速定位代码错误,降低调试时间,提高软件稳定性。在复杂系统开发中,这些功能尤其重要。
性能分析方面,VS2012提供了性能剖析器和内存分析工具,能够详细记录应用程序运行情况,检测性能瓶颈和资源消耗。开发者可以通过这些工具优化算法,提升系统响应速度和整体效率。
实际应用中,调试和性能分析结合使用,可以在早期阶段发现潜在问题,避免上线后出现严重bug,确保项目按计划高质量完成。
VS2012在团队协作方面提供了完整支持,通过源代码管理和版本控制工具,团队成员能够同步更新代码、追踪变更历史和解决冲突。在多人参与的开发环境中,这些功能显著减少了沟通成本和开发风险。
结合工作项管理和任务跟踪功能,开发团队可以清晰分配任务、监控进度,并在开发过程中保持高度协同。这种机制确保了项目进度透明化,有助于按时交付高质量软件。
此外,VS2012还支持与外部版本控制系统如Git和TFS的集成,进一步扩展了团队协作能力,使开发者能够灵活选择工具链并优化项目管理流程。
在实际项目中,VS2012不仅是开发工具,更是项目管理和开发流程优化的重要支撑。通过合理配置IDE和调试工具,开发者可以在不同规模的项目中快速适应,提高工作效率和代码质量。
例如,在企业级应用开发中,利用VS2012的性能分析和团队协作功能可以确保大型系统的稳定性和可维护性。在小型项目或独立开发者环境中,IDE的高效编程和模板管理功能同样能够节省大量时间和精力。
综合来看,VS2012的三大核心功能在不同场景下均能发挥重要作用,为开发者提供从编码到部署的一站式解决方案,真正体现了全方位指南的价值。
2026世界杯指定网站,2026·世界杯(FIFAWorldCup),2026世界杯(WorldCup)-官方指定网站,2026·美加墨世界杯(WorldCup)官方网站总结:
本文通过对VS2012三大核心功能的深入解析,详细阐述了集成开发环境优化、代码调试与性能分析以及团队协作与版本控制在实际应用中的价值。文章不仅分析了各功能的技术特点,还结合具体应用场景提供了操作策略和实践建议,为开发者提供了可操作性强的参考。
总的来看,VS2012凭借其强大的IDE支持、完善的调试与分析工具以及高效的团队协作能力,实现了软件开发流程的全面优化。无论是大型企业项目还是个人开发者任务,这些核心功能都能够显著提升开发效率和软件质量,为开发者在实践中提供可靠保障。
